Output efa09772ea239753ccf73186070e40889521601c1be56d3e86af64143e490304:1

value
13070326121
script pubkey
OP_0 OP_PUSHBYTES_20 e4252d99422e3df20b3ee6e2c3caa878e9a9885f
address
ltc1qusjjmx2z9c7lyze7um3v8j4g0r56nzzl82pqcj
transaction
efa09772ea239753ccf73186070e40889521601c1be56d3e86af64143e490304
spent
true